RMG93TW6–Portrait of novelist and author Barbara Cartland at home with one of her beloved dogs, sitting in one of the gaily painted rooms in a bright pink dress offset by the flowers that surround her and the peacock blue walls. Dame Barbara lived and worked since 1950 at Camfield Place, formerly the home of Beatrix Potter, a ten-bedroom mansion set in 400 acres of farmland and woods near Hatfield, Hertfordshire.

RMG51G38–PA Photo 11/12/1984 Barbara Cartland takes tea with two young cub scouts at her Hatfield home Herfordshire, part of a nationwide 'Take Time for Tea' scheme. BBC Television John Craven who is fronting the scheme involving some 500 cub scout packs looks on as Simon Redman (10 years old right) and Ashley Williams (9 years) serve tea to the authoress
